# Anatomy data and attribution The Orthonotes 3D skeleton began with `public/skeleton.glb` from [BodyExplorer](https://github.com/JohanBellander/BodyExplorer), revision `7d04bf3c4de2bd9cb234dd51d7e6857c099afafd`. Phase 2B replaced the runtime file with the unmodified Z-Anatomy `skeletal_male.glb` export from Anatria-3D revision `697cc364e1cea1f5f15bad920ea87426f36c0446`, so all Phase 2 layers share one source scene. The earlier BodyExplorer-derived file remains archived under `scripts/_asset_work/phase2/` for traceability. BodyExplorer credits: - **BodyParts3D / DBCLS**, licensed under [CC BY-SA 2.1 Japan](https://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-sa/2.1/jp/deed.en). - **Z-Anatomy** by Gauthier Kervyn, licensed under [CC BY-SA 4.0](https://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-sa/4.0/). - **BodyExplorer** for its derived/processed GLB and application processing. Its source code is described as MIT licensed; anatomical assets retain their source-data licences. Phase 2 muscle, tendon and ligament geometry comes from the CC BY-SA 4.0 male atlas assets in [Anatria-3D](https://github.com/Nurkan1/Anatria-3D), documented web exports of Z-Anatomy. `muscular-male.glb` and `articular-male.glb` retain the published geometry. `tendons.glb` extracts six explicitly named tendon nodes and recompresses them with Draco without anatomical deformation. The assets and derived files remain under their applicable attribution and ShareAlike terms. Open-source licensing is not evidence of clinical validation. Full provenance is maintained in `docs/ORTHONOTES_3D_ASSET_LICENSES.md`.
